Agricultural greenhouse gases emissions — Cropland in Lithuania
Lithuania: Agricultural greenhouse gases emissions — Cropland was 31.72 Tonnes of CO2-equivalent in 2023. ◆ Volatile
Agricultural greenhouse gases emissions — Cropland in Lithuania, 1990–2023
Source: Organisation for Economic Co-operation and Development. Measured in Tonnes of CO2-equivalent.
Analysis
In 2023, agricultural greenhouse gases emissions — cropland in Lithuania stood at 31.72 Tonnes of CO2-equivalent.
The figure is down 67.0% on the previous year and down 93.4% over ten years.
Over the whole period, agricultural greenhouse gases emissions — cropland in Lithuania peaked at 1,636 Tonnes of CO2-equivalent in 1990 and was at its lowest, 20.54 Tonnes of CO2-equivalent, in 2016.
The series is highly variable year to year, so single readings are best treated with caution.
Agricultural greenhouse gases emissions — Cropland in Lithuania, year by year
| Year | Tonnes of CO2-equivalent | Change |
|---|---|---|
| 1990 | 1,636 Tonnes of CO2-equivalent | — |
| 1991 | 1,579 Tonnes of CO2-equivalent | -3.4% |
| 1992 | 1,563 Tonnes of CO2-equivalent | -1.0% |
| 1993 | 1,464 Tonnes of CO2-equivalent | -6.4% |
| 1994 | 1,479 Tonnes of CO2-equivalent | +1.0% |
| 1995 | 1,408 Tonnes of CO2-equivalent | -4.8% |
| 1996 | 1,231 Tonnes of CO2-equivalent | -12.6% |
| 1997 | 1,290 Tonnes of CO2-equivalent | +4.8% |
| 1998 | 1,368 Tonnes of CO2-equivalent | +6.1% |
| 1999 | 1,430 Tonnes of CO2-equivalent | +4.5% |
| 2000 | 1,392 Tonnes of CO2-equivalent | -2.6% |
| 2001 | 1,187 Tonnes of CO2-equivalent | -14.8% |
| 2002 | 1,099 Tonnes of CO2-equivalent | -7.4% |
| 2003 | 864.12 Tonnes of CO2-equivalent | -21.3% |
| 2004 | 882.57 Tonnes of CO2-equivalent | +2.1% |
| 2005 | 966.94 Tonnes of CO2-equivalent | +9.6% |
| 2006 | 1,444 Tonnes of CO2-equivalent | +49.3% |
| 2007 | 1,384 Tonnes of CO2-equivalent | -4.1% |
| 2008 | 1,403 Tonnes of CO2-equivalent | +1.3% |
| 2009 | 1,133 Tonnes of CO2-equivalent | -19.2% |
| 2010 | 497.54 Tonnes of CO2-equivalent | -56.1% |
| 2011 | 697.23 Tonnes of CO2-equivalent | +40.1% |
| 2012 | 470.38 Tonnes of CO2-equivalent | -32.5% |
| 2013 | 479.38 Tonnes of CO2-equivalent | +1.9% |
| 2014 | 515.14 Tonnes of CO2-equivalent | +7.5% |
| 2015 | 173.44 Tonnes of CO2-equivalent | -66.3% |
| 2016 | 20.54 Tonnes of CO2-equivalent | -88.2% |
| 2017 | 244.96 Tonnes of CO2-equivalent | +1092.8% |
| 2018 | 288.69 Tonnes of CO2-equivalent | +17.8% |
| 2019 | 306.54 Tonnes of CO2-equivalent | +6.2% |
| 2020 | 51.69 Tonnes of CO2-equivalent | -83.1% |
| 2021 | 56.39 Tonnes of CO2-equivalent | +9.1% |
| 2022 | 96.17 Tonnes of CO2-equivalent | +70.5% |
| 2023 | 31.72 Tonnes of CO2-equivalent | -67.0% |
